Diet and Fluid intake for Optimal Visual Ability
The nutrition you pick directly benefits your eyes. Taking in the proper vitamins and minerals enables your retina remain healthy and reduces strain. Consuming enough water is equally vital, because dehydration can make dry eyes worse and impair your concentration.
Gamers should choose foods with Lutein and Zeaxanthin, like kale and spinach. Omega-3 fatty acids from fish like salmon are beneficial, and so are Vitamins A, C, and E. Adding a mix of colourful fruits and vegetables on your plate builds a natural defense for your tireless eyes.

Building the Optimal Gaming Environment for Eye Health
Your room setup matters a lot for how your eyes respond. The light around you needs to be soft and even, so it doesn’t compete badly with your screen. Never play in a pitch-black room. That forces your eyes to struggle with the contrast between the bright screen and the dark surroundings.
A good quality monitor is a worthwhile investment. Find one where you can adjust the brightness and colour temperature. Lots of newer models have a “low blue light” setting great for night-time play. Furthermore, wipe your screen clean of dust and fingerprints. A smudgy screen creates visual clutter and discomfort.
Recognizing the Digital Eye Strain Problem
Digital Eye Strain, sometimes known as Computer Vision Syndrome, is common for people who spend time on screens a lot. Gamers experience it more often because of their deep focus and long sessions soaked in blue light. The bright, high-contrast graphics in games like Chicken Plus Game can cause things worse if you aren’t careful.
Signs Every Gamer Should Spot
Being aware of the warning signs allows you to act early. Check for sore, tired, or burning eyes. Your vision might go blurry for a moment, or light might begin to feel too bright. You could also develop neck and shoulder aches from sitting wrong during a marathon gaming stint.
The Blue Light Aspect
Your screen emits high-energy visible blue light. This light can travel deep into your eye. Too much exposure, particularly if you game late into the night, can mess with your sleep and make your eyes feeling more tired. Controlling blue light is a big part of eye care for gamers.
When to Look for Professional Eye Care Advice
Healthy habits help, but a professional opinion is crucial. If you suffer from constant eye inflammation, pain, big shifts in your eyesight, or regular head pains after gaming sessions, visit an optometrist straight immediately. These could point to something that needs treatment.
Even if you are fine, adults should have a routine eye test every two years, or more frequently if your optician recommends so. Tell them about your gaming. When they know your lifestyle, they can give you tips that actually matches your life.
